> JD Daniels wrote:
> > I have changed it so that the template that figures out the width uses a
> > param i pass it, but how can I figure out if the table is inside a table
> > cell, and pass it the value of the parent table cells parent
fo:table-column
> > width?
>
> Use something like
>   <xsl:if test="ancestor::table">
> Better yet, always pass the current block width down through all
> templates matching block level elements, and pass the page width
> in the top level template.
>
> I mean
>
> <xsl:template match="table|tbody">
>    <xsl:param name="blockwidth"/>
>    <fo:table>
>    ...
>     <xsl:call-template name="process-col-width">
>       ...
>       <xsl:with-param name="parentblockwidth"
>            select="$blockwidth"/>
>      ...
>    <fo:table-body>
>      <xsl:apply-templates>
>       <xsl:with-param name="blockwidth"
>            select="$blockwidth"/>
>      </xsl:apply-templates>
>    </fo:table-body>
>
>
> Watch out for default templates, they will ruin it.
